One of the most praised aspects of Cricket 19 was its artificial intelligence. In earlier cricket games, computer-controlled opponents often followed rigid, predictable patterns. In Cricket 19 , the AI was programmed to adapt. If a player constantly bowled short deliveries, the AI batsmen would settle into a hook-shot rhythm. If the player attacked aggressively, the AI would look to rotate the strike and tire out the bowlers. This forced players to think strategically, setting fields and varying pace, much like a real captain.
The Career Mode is where Cricket 19 truly shined. Players could create a custom athlete and start at the bottom of the domestic ladder. Unlike simple "season" modes, this career mode included RPG-like elements. Media interviews, training drills to boost specific stats, and the management of stamina and form all played a role. The ultimate goal—earning the Baggy Green (or your nation's equivalent) and playing in The Ashes—gave the game a satisfying narrative arc that could last hundreds of hours. Cricket 19-Razor1911
